In the Linux kernel, the following vulnerability has been resolved: sunrpc: fix one UAF issue caused by sunrpc kernel tcp socket. This vulnerability allows a use-after-free condition that could lead to system instability or unauthorized access.
With a CVSS score of 7.8, this vulnerability is classified as high severity, indicating significant potential impact on affected systems. Risk to organizations includes the possibility of local attackers exploiting this vulnerability to gain elevated privileges or disrupt services.
Currently, there is no public exploit confirmed for this vulnerability, but the nature of the issue suggests that it could be exploited if not addressed promptly. Organizations should prioritize patching immediately.
The vulnerability was published on December 27, 2024, with a modified status indicating that it has received updates in the kernel. Organizations using affected versions must act swiftly to safeguard their environments.
Vulnerability Details
The vulnerability allows a use-after-free condition in the Linux kernel's sunrpc module, specifically within the tcp_write_timer_handler function. This could potentially result in unauthorized access or system crashes.
The vulnerability is categorized under CWE-416, which pertains to use-after-free vulnerabilities. Organizations should take note that the attack vector is local, requiring low privileges and no user interaction.
The affected component is the Linux kernel, and the issue has been tracked under CVE-2024-53168. The publication date of the CVE was December 27, 2024.
Technical Analysis
The root cause of the vulnerability lies within the management of kernel memory for TCP sockets in the sunrpc module. Specifically, the issue arises when a TCP socket is improperly freed while a timer is still active.
The attack vector is local, as a user with low privileges can exploit the flaw. The attack complexity is low, meaning that the vulnerability could be easily leveraged. The affected systems suffer high confidentiality, integrity, and availability impacts.
Risk & Impact Analysis
Real-world deployment risk associated with this vulnerability includes potential system crashes and unauthorized access. The blast radius could affect systems running the Linux kernel, especially in environments where multiple users have local access.
Organizations should assess their use of the Linux kernel and prioritize remediation efforts based on the high CVSS score. With the known exploitation status of no confirmed public exploits, it is crucial to remain vigilant.
Given the high severity, organizations should address this vulnerability in their priority patch cycle.
Exploitation Status
Signal | Status |
|---|---|
Known Exploit | No |
Public PoC | No |
Actively Exploited | No |
Ransomware Use | No |
Affected Versions
The following versions of the Linux kernel are affected by this vulnerability: versions 4.2 to less than 6.6.64, 6.7 to less than 6.11.11, and 6.12 to less than 6.12.2.
Mitigation & Remediation
Organizations should apply the latest patches provided by the Linux kernel maintainers. Affected users should upgrade to versions 6.12.2 or later to mitigate this vulnerability.
If patches are not immediately available, consider implementing network isolation measures to limit access to vulnerable systems until a patch can be applied. Regular monitoring of system logs for unusual activity is also recommended.
Penetration testing can also help validate the effectiveness of applied patches.
Detection Guidance
Monitor logs for signs of exploitation attempts. Look for unusual TCP traffic patterns or kernel crashes that may indicate exploitation of this vulnerability.
Behavioral anomalies related to network namespace management should also be scrutinized.
AppSecure Threat Intelligence Insight
The long-term significance of this vulnerability highlights a pattern of local vulnerabilities in kernel space that could be leveraged by attackers with local access. Security teams should remain vigilant and incorporate lessons learned from this incident into their security protocols.
This incident underscores the importance of regular patching and the role of continuous security assessments.
Penetration testing methodology should be reviewed regularly to ensure defenses remain robust against similar vulnerabilities.
A vulnerability management program should also be implemented to proactively address potential threats.
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

.webp)